How to get a Bulletproof Car in GTA San Andreas

Yo, snagging a bulletproof car in GTA San Andreas is like finding a diamond in the rough, but it's totally doable. Zoom into 'Gray Imports' mission, where you gotta take down a dude named Crack. When he tries to escape, don't blow up his car. Instead, take him down, then swipe his bulletproof car. Another gem is during the 'End of the Line' mission. Save Sweet, and you'll get to keep a fireproof, damage-proof, and bulletproof Greenwood car. Neat, huh?
